#51f135 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#51f135 is composed of 31.8% red, 94.5% green and 20.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 66.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 78% yellow and 5.5% black. It has a hue angle of 111.1 degrees, a saturation of 87% and a lightness of 57.6%. #51f135 color hex could be obtained by blending #a2ff6a with #00e300. Closest websafe color is: #66ff33.

#51f135 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#51f135 has RGB values of R:81, G:241, B:53 and CMYK values of C:0.66, M:0, Y:0.78, K:0.05. Its decimal value is 5370165.

Shades and Tints of #51f135
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#041201 is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.
